Output e0b7309e176e4f13af5e6273cde3043a00687eb68c821726f9fc3cca506d10ec:0

value
770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a13dba68bb9614654cded4feaa1cb5c9b042c12 OP_EQUAL
address
3BMuLdsTKPHQgP1uB9bBjZGpyFJy1pSn6G
transaction
e0b7309e176e4f13af5e6273cde3043a00687eb68c821726f9fc3cca506d10ec
confirmations
225375
spent
true